Simplifying an expression is getting rid of any brackets or parentheses, performing as many operations as you can - including combining like terms. To evaluate an expression you would substitute the numerical values of all the variables, carry out all the operations (addition, multiplication etc) in the expression to reach the answer - the numerical value of the expression.
To simplify a variable expression by evaluating its numerical part, first identify and calculate any numerical constants or coefficients present in the expression. Combine these numerical values through addition, subtraction, multiplication, or division as appropriate. After simplifying the numerical part, rewrite the expression by maintaining the variable components, resulting in a more concise and easier-to-understand form. For example, in the expression 3x + 5x, the numerical part (3 + 5) simplifies to 8, resulting in 8x.

In mathematics, to evaluate means to find the numerical value of an expression or equation. This involves substituting given values into the expression and simplifying it to obtain a single numerical result. Evaluation is a fundamental process in mathematics used to determine the outcome of mathematical operations and expressions.
